I was watching news on television as scientists explained what went haywire with the big old Hubble telescope. Seems like an ironic expression. A billion dollar telescope goes haywire? I wondered if those NASA officials had ever been around real haywire before.

Some words are too good to keep on the ranch. In fact, many kids raised on a ranch today have never seen haywire either. Most bales these days come tied with orange poly plastic twine. But for about a century, hay had been secured with two thin, tough wires. Once cut and hay fed to cows, you gathered the wire and twisted it in some haphazard fashion. Then, you tried to toss it far away from the cattle.

The Dangers

My neighbor lost a $3,000 bull when it swallowed a haywire. Uncounted numbers of livestock have died over the years from ingesting bits of haywire. Around the ranch there used to be a barrel or pile or gunny sack with wadded up wire. The word began to take on the symbolism of anything crazy or muddled or twisted up.
